From an engineering standpoint, the A7’s spoiler is not merely decorative—it’s a carefully calibrated part of Audi’s aerodynamic system. When the car reaches higher speeds, the spoiler automatically deploys to create additional downforce on the rear axle. This stabilizes the vehicle by pressing the tires more firmly to the road surface, reducing lift and improving traction during high-speed cruising or cornering. Once the speed drops, the spoiler retracts seamlessly to preserve the vehicle’s sleek fastback silhouette and reduce unnecessary air resistance.

The design of the Audi A7 rear spoiler varies depending on the model generation and trim level. On newer models, especially the A7 Sportback, the spoiler is fully integrated into the rear hatch and controlled electronically. Its movement is managed by a dedicated control unit connected to the vehicle’s dynamic systems, ensuring that deployment occurs precisely when needed. In contrast, aftermarket or performance-oriented versions often include fixed spoilers made from lightweight materials like carbon fiber, ABS plastic, or fiberglass. These alternatives not only enhance the sporty aesthetic but also offer additional aerodynamic benefits for enthusiasts seeking a more aggressive appearance.

Material selection plays a vital role in the spoiler’s functionality and durability. OEM Audi spoilers are typically made from high-grade, impact-resistant polymers or lightweight aluminum alloys, offering excellent balance between strength, weight, and corrosion resistance. Premium versions, especially those from performance divisions like Audi Sport or ABT Sportsline, may utilize carbon fiber composites, delivering superior rigidity and reduced weight. The surface is treated with UV-resistant coatings and precision paint finishes that match the vehicle’s original color codes, ensuring both longevity and a factory-quality appearance.

Installation methods also vary. Factory-equipped Audi A7 models include a built-in electronic lift mechanism, while aftermarket spoilers may require adhesive mounting, drilling, or bolt-on installation depending on the design. Professional installation is highly recommended, as proper alignment and secure fitting are essential for both aesthetics and aerodynamic function. When correctly installed, the spoiler not only enhances appearance but also contributes to better airflow management over the rear section, leading to improved fuel efficiency and reduced turbulence.

Beyond aesthetics, safety and performance benefits are also notable. At highway speeds, a properly functioning rear spoiler can improve braking stability by keeping the rear end planted during deceleration. It reduces lift that could otherwise cause lightness or instability, especially on wet or uneven roads. Moreover, in performance tuning scenarios, pairing the spoiler with upgraded suspension or wider tires can result in significantly enhanced handling and cornering performance.

Maintenance of the rear spoiler is relatively simple. Regular cleaning with non-abrasive products helps preserve the paint and coating. For models with an automatic lifting system, periodic inspection of the motor and wiring ensures smooth operation. Any malfunction—such as the spoiler failing to deploy—should be addressed promptly, as it may affect aerodynamic balance and even trigger dashboard warning lights.
